python mongodb connection

43

	#PreRequisite install pymono
	#pip install pymongo
	from pymongo import MongoClient
  
  	# connect to MongoDB, change the << MONGODB URL >> if connection details are different
  	client = MongoClient("mongodb://127.0.0.1:27017")
    print("Connection Successful")
    
    db=client.admin
    # Issue the serverStatus command and print the results
	serverStatusResult=db.command("serverStatus")
    
    #We can now create a database object referencing a new database, 
	#called “business”, as follows:
	db = client.business
    
    # Create the database for our example (we will use the same database throughout the tutorial
    return client['user_shopping_list']
    
# This is added so that many files can reuse the function get_database()
if __name__ == "__main__":    
    
    # Get the database
    dbname = get_database()
    
    client.close()
def get_database():
    from pymongo import MongoClient
    import pymongo

    # Provide the mongodb atlas url to connect python to mongodb using pymongo
    CONNECTION_STRING = "mongodb+srv://<username>:<password>@<cluster-name>.mongodb.net/myFirstDatabase"

    # Create a connection using MongoClient. You can import MongoClient or use pymongo.MongoClient
    from pymongo import MongoClient
    client = MongoClient(CONNECTION_STRING)

    # Create the database for our example (we will use the same database throughout the tutorial
    return client['user_shopping_list']
    
# This is added so that many files can reuse the function get_database()
if __name__ == "__main__":    
    
    # Get the database
    dbname = get_database()

Comments

Submit
0 Comments